Citizen Developer
Timespan
explore our new search
​
Power Apps: Discover the Magic of Default Screen Templates
Power Apps
Dec 27, 2024 5:44 PM

Power Apps: Discover the Magic of Default Screen Templates

by HubSite 365 about Vipul Jain [MVP]

Consultant - M365, Power Platform, SharePoint, Azure, React JS | Speaker | Author | Trainer | C# Corner MVP

Power Apps Studio, screen templates, Meeting template, Calendar template, Approval template, business requirements

Key insights

  • Power Apps offers a variety of out-of-the-box (OOTB) screen templates to streamline app development with pre-built functionalities.

  • The Meeting Template allows users to schedule meetings within the app, featuring attendee selection, scheduling options, and integration with Outlook for calendar events.

  • The Calendar Template provides a visual display of scheduled events, integrating with Outlook and utilizing gallery controls for interactive navigation through dates.

  • The Approval Template (with Workflow History) enables creation of approval workflows, supporting submission of items for approval and integration with Power Automate for process handling.

  • These templates are responsive and customizable, allowing developers to tailor them to specific business needs while ensuring seamless integration with Microsoft Office capabilities.

  • Utilizing these templates accelerates the app-building process by providing familiar interfaces and functionalities that enhance user experience.

Introduction to Power Apps Default Screen Templates

Power Apps, a part of Microsoft's Power Platform, offers a range of out-of-the-box (OOTB) screen templates that simplify app development by providing pre-built functionalities. In a recent video by Vipul Jain, a Microsoft MVP, these templates are explored in detail, highlighting their potential to meet various business requirements. The video focuses on three primary templates: Meeting, Calendar, and Approval (with workflow history). These templates not only streamline the app-building process but also integrate seamlessly with Outlook capabilities, providing users with familiar interfaces.

Meeting Template: Streamlining Scheduling

The Meeting screen template is designed to facilitate the scheduling of meetings directly within an app. This template includes several key features that enhance its functionality:
  • Attendee Selection: Users can easily search for and add attendees from their organization, simplifying the process of inviting participants to meetings.
  • Scheduling: The template allows users to set meeting dates, times, and durations, ensuring that all necessary details are captured efficiently.
  • Integration: There is seamless connectivity with Outlook, enabling the creation of calendar events upon submission, which helps in maintaining consistency across platforms.
Moreover, this template demonstrates the implementation of tabs within a screen, which enhances the user interface design. By utilizing this template, developers can save time and effort, avoiding the need to build scheduling functionalities from scratch.

Calendar Template: Visualizing Events

The Calendar screen template provides a visual representation of scheduled events, making it easier for users to manage their time. Its features include:
  • Event Display: The template shows events for selected dates, integrating with the user’s Outlook calendar to provide a comprehensive view of their schedule.
  • Interactive Navigation: Users can navigate through dates to view corresponding events, allowing for easy access to information.
This template is particularly useful for learning about galleries in Power Apps, as it utilizes multiple gallery controls to build the calendar view. By leveraging this template, developers can create intuitive and interactive calendars without extensive coding, thus enhancing user engagement.

Approval Template: Facilitating Workflow Management

The Approval screen template is designed to facilitate the creation of approval workflows within an app. It is particularly beneficial for scenarios requiring data, decisions, or documents to be reviewed by stakeholders. Key aspects of this template include:
  • Approval Requests: Users can submit items for approval, which are then routed to designated approvers, streamlining the approval process.
  • Workflow Integration: Often combined with Power Automate, this feature handles the approval process efficiently, ensuring that all necessary steps are completed.
  • Approval Stages: The template displays details such as approver names, titles, statuses, and indicates the current stage of the approval process, providing transparency and clarity.
By using this template, developers can create robust approval systems that cater to specific business needs, ensuring that processes are both efficient and transparent.

Customization and Responsiveness of Templates

One of the significant advantages of using Power Apps templates is their responsiveness and customizability. These templates are designed to be adaptable, allowing app makers to tailor them to specific business requirements. This flexibility ensures that the apps not only meet the immediate needs of the organization but can also evolve as those needs change over time. Furthermore, the integration with Microsoft Office capabilities means that users are presented with interfaces that are familiar and intuitive. This familiarity reduces the learning curve, enabling users to adopt new apps quickly and efficiently.

Conclusion: Accelerating App Development

In conclusion, the use of Power Apps default screen templates offers a strategic advantage for developers looking to accelerate the app-building process. By providing pre-built functionalities, these templates save time and effort, allowing developers to focus on customization and integration rather than starting from scratch. The Meeting, Calendar, and Approval templates, as highlighted by Vipul Jain, demonstrate the potential of these tools to meet diverse business needs while ensuring seamless integration with existing Office applications. As a result, organizations can enhance productivity and efficiency, ultimately achieving their business objectives more effectively.

Power Apps - Unlocking Power Apps: Discover the Magic of Default Screen Templates

Keywords

Power Apps templates, OOTB screen templates, default Power Apps screens, Power Apps design tips, customizing Power Apps screens, Power Apps UI templates, built-in screen templates Power Apps, optimizing Power Apps layouts